Utilizamos cookies propias y de terceros para mejorar la experiencia de navegación, y ofrecer contenidos y publicidad de interés.
Al continuar con la navegación entendemos que se acepta nuestra política de cookies.
Iniciar sesión Cerrar
Correo:
Contraseña:
Entrar
Recordar sesión en este navegador
Crear cuenta

Delphi - Inventario

Vista:
Me gusta: Está pregunta es útil y esta clara
0
No me gusta: Está pregunta no esta clara o no es útil
 
Asunto:Inventario
Autor:Delfino (11 intervenciones)
Fecha:17/12/2002 22:08:20
Hola: Tengo una tabla llamada ventas, con un campo llamado cantidad_venta. Tambien otra tabla llamada Inventario, con un campo llamado Existencia, yo quiero lograr que se haga una transaccion donde se descuente de Existencia la cantidad_venta.

Quiero ver si me dan un ejemplo con TQuery y con TTable a ver cual me conviene mas. Se que hay muchas personas capacitadas que me pueden ayudar. Gracias....
Responder Subir
información
Otras secciones de LWP con contenido similar...
Me gusta: Está respuesta es útil y esta clara
0
No me gusta: Está respuesta no esta clara o no es útil
 
Asunto:RE:Inventario
Autor:MDG (4 intervenciones)
Fecha:19/12/2002 16:52:28
con el TQuery : no conosco la estructura de las tablas pero imagino que en ambas tienes un campo para el codigo del producto, asi :
Sql.Clear;
Sql.Add('UPDATE INVENTARIO SET EXISTENCIA = EXIXTENCIA - :P1');
Sql.Add('WHERE COD_PRODUCTO = :P2');
Params[0].Value := {Valor a descontar};
Params[1].Value := {Codigo del producto};
ExecSQL;

con el TTable seria:
tblInventario.Open;
tblInvenatrio.Locate('cod_producto',Codigo producto,[]);
tblInventario.Edit;
tblInventario.FieldByName('existencia').Value := tblInventario.FieldByName('existencia').Value - Cantidad a descontar;
tblInventario.Post;
Comentar Subir